Motorcycle throttle not turning is due to the throttle cable being frozen. Low winter temperatures are unfavorable for engine startup, and without proper measures, it can accelerate engine wear. Use low-viscosity grade engine oil: As temperatures drop, it is recommended to use low-viscosity grade engine oil to meet the engine's viscosity requirements in winter and extend the engine's service life. Increase electrolyte concentration: For motorcycles equipped with an electric start system, if a non-maintenance-free battery is used, the concentration of the battery electrolyte should be appropriately increased. This enhances the battery's activity at low temperatures, reduces the possibility of sulfation, and requires attention to supplemental charging. When using the electric start, if it fails to start on the first attempt, wait 10 to 15 seconds before trying again, and each starting attempt should not exceed 5 seconds.
